    ALIPAC Calls for Mitt Romney To Respond To Obama's Executive Decree Amnesty

    June 15, 2012

    Contact: Americans for Legal Immigration PAC (ALIPAC)
    (866) 703-0864 / WilliamG@alipac.us

    Americans for Legal Immigration PAC is calling for Mitt Romney (857-288-3500) to release his statement regarding Barack Obama's executive decree Dream Act amnesty announcement today since Romney has remained silent on this story of national importance.

    "Mitt Romney's silence today is deafening!" said William Gheen President of ALIPAC. "Romney has promised voters he would veto the Dream Act, will push illegal aliens out of America through increased immigration enforcement, and turn off illegal immigration magnets. Obama just bypassed Congress, our existing laws, the elections and the US Constitution to do contradict everything Romney promised. Where is Mitt Romney on Obama's historic and and nation shaking actions today?"

    A Wall Street Journal online poll is showing 66% public opposition to Obama's amnesty announcement.

    Americans for Legal Immigration PAC believes that American voters need leaders that take on tough issues head on. Today's announcement by Obama is unprecedented in American history. Some have suggested that despite his tough rhetoric about illegal immigration, that Mitt Romney serves the same Council on Foreign Relations and Goldman Sachs masters as Obama and thus would eventually have an identical agenda regarding illegal immigration.

    "Mitt Romney needs to come out and oppose both Obama's Dream Act Amnesty and Obama's use of dictatorial powers to overthrow the functions of the Congress and the American Republic," said William Gheen in a second release Friday afternoon. "Otherwise, Mitt Romney's silence will suggest acquiescence to both!"
